Rear Diff/Axles ???

I want to just use the Impreza differential for my 5spd swap since it is a direct bolt up minus the fact its not a LSD and the SVX rear axles will not work.

I thought I could just get axles from the donor car ('99 Impreza RS) but they are a tad shorter and the outside end is way to small!

I remember reading some axles would work...can't remember which cars.

I need to know if the early Legacy ('90-94) rear halfshafts have the same outer end as the SVX. As I said the '99 RS shafts I bought do not even come close to fitting.

You should swap the gears from the Impreza diff into the SVX diff. That way you get to keep your LSD (but with matching ratios) and use stock SVX axles.

I swapped the rear diff ring and pinion myself with a mechanic friend that does em, we found it to be easy and required no shimming, direct swap.

The time I drove my car before the trans died it was like I never touched it.
